Directions

  1. Make The Dressing:
  2. In a small bowl add buttermilk,mayo,scallions,cayenne,black pepper,salt and celery seed.Using a whisk mix thoroughly until it is thick like buttermilk.
  3. Cut the cabbage in half, lengthwise down the core.Then cut each cabbage half into 4 wedges again lengthwise down the core.In total you should have 8 wedges.Sprinkle cabbage with salt as needed. Heat the grill to medium high coat the grill with oil.Cook cabbage wedges until wilted and apparent grill marks have formed on the outside of the cabbage about 2-3 minutes per side. Remove from the grill and transfer to a platter. Drizzle with buttermilk dressing and serve.
